WordPress как на ладони
Недорогой хостинг для сайтов на WordPress: wordpress.jino.ru

Advanced Custom Fields

Advanced Custom Fields - это популярный WordPress плагин для разработчиков, позволяющий добавлять метаполя куда угодно и выводить их значения где угодно. В этом руководстве вы найдете массу примеров использования этого плагина, но для начала небольшой экскурс в его возможности.

Простой и интуитивный интерфейс

Создайте группу полей, добавьте в неё нужные вам поля и укажите, где их отображать. Готово! Остаётся заполнить их информацией.

Сделан для разработчиков

В основе плагина Advanced Custom Fields лежит простой и интуитивно понятный API. Используйте функции, такие как get_field() и the_field(), чтобы быстро создавать мощные шаблоны.

А также вы можете создавать группы полей как через визуальный интерфейс, так и кодом.

Большое количество типов полей

Advanced Custom Fields включает себя более 30 типов полей (и сотни созданных пользователями), что позволяет решать практически любые задачи и делать сайт максимально функциональным!

Читайте о всех полях и сопутствующем функционале ACF в официальной документации.

5 комментов
  • @ Иван www.facebook.com/polianskyi.ivan

    Как можно создавать группы полей кодом, без визуального интерфейса?

    Ответить3.Июл.2019 16:57 #
    • campusboy3542 www.youtube.com/c/wpplus

      Здравствуйте. Читайте этот материал "Register fields via PHP".

      1
      Ответить3.Июл.2019 16:59 #
      • Меня смущает, что нельзя удалить ГРУППУ полей средствами php. Почему? Что скажете об альтернативе в виде плагина Pods?

        Ответить30.Мар.2020 22:29 #
  • @ Myakish6 ssa0@yandex.ru

    Плагин классный,

    рассказали бы ещё (с примерами) как потом формировать запрос для get_fields или WP_Query для фильтрации полей по тому или иному дополнительному полю.
    Очень интересует вариант адресации для элементов полей "Повторитель" в "Повторителе"

    Ответить11.Май.2020 15:48 #
  • Дмитрий

    Подскажите пожалуйста, можно ли самому задать место вывода кастомных полей в админке? Например добавить настройку в товаре woocommerce прямо под тем местом где мы указываем атрибут.

    Ответить4.Июн.2020 10:39 #